Just north of Mexico City’s Chapultepec Park, the upscale district of Polanco is a haven for some of the country’s wealthiest families. The area is characterized by high-end real estate, luxurious hotels, and pricy restaurants that line its streets. Divided into five distinct neighborhoods, Polanco offers a blend of modern sophistication and green spaces, with Parque Lincoln at its heart. Visitors can stroll through the welcoming park, explore the upscale boutiques, and savor the culinary offerings in this vibrant, affluent part of the city.
